Pearl River County, Mississippi Farm Subsidies
Pearl River County, Mississippi received $16M in USDA farm subsidy payments across 1,126 records from FY2010 to FY2025. That averages $17.90 per resident per year based on Census Bureau population estimates.
120 named recipients on record (historical, through ~2019).
- RURAL RENTAL ASSISTANCE PAYMENTS
- $10,981K
- CONSERVATION RESERVE PROGRAM
- $1,439K
- PRICE LOSS COVERAGE
- $225K
- CROP INSURANCE
- $133K
| Year | Total | $/Capita |
|---|---|---|
| FY2025 | $1,271K | $21.92 |
| FY2024 | $1,015K | $17.50 |
| FY2023 | $1,229K | $21.20 |
| FY2022 | $1,390K | $24.30 |
| FY2021 | $610K | $10.80 |
| FY2020 | $1,151K | $20.47 |
| FY2019 | $1,129K | $20.25 |
| FY2018 | $1,203K | $21.68 |
| FY2017 | $750K | $13.55 |
| FY2016 | $1,293K | $23.47 |
| FY2015 | $718K | $13.06 |
| FY2014 | $797K | $14.45 |
| FY2013 | $736K | $13.42 |
| FY2012 | $1,155K | $21.00 |
| FY2011 | $1,063K | $19.18 |
| FY2010 | $566K | $10.16 |

What is the farm subsidy per capita in Pearl River County, Mississippi?
Pearl River County, Mississippi averaged $17.90 per resident per year in USDA farm subsidy payments from FY2010 through FY2025. This figure is calculated using annual Census Bureau population estimates matched to each fiscal year. Per-capita figures reflect total subsidy dollars — including payments to farms, businesses, and individuals — divided by the county's total population, not just the farm population.
